Fort Lauderdale, known as the \"Venice of America,\" is a picturesque coastal city in Florida that offers endless opportunities for exploration and adventure. Here are some of the top spots and activities that you won’t want to miss during your trip: 1. Beaches - Fort Lauderdale is known for its sandy beaches that stretch for miles along the ocean. From relaxing on a towel to swimming in the ocean, there is something for everyone. 2. Las Olas Boulevard - This vibrant strip of shops, restaurants, cafes, and galleries is a must-visit spot in Fort Lauderdale. Take a stroll here and check out the local boutiques and unique home goods stores. 3. Everglades National Park - Located just a short drive from Fort Lauderdale, the Everglades offers a glimpse into Florida’s natural beauty. Take an airboat ride or hike through the park to see alligators, birds, and other wildlife. 4. Bonnet House Museum & Gardens - Step back in time and explore this 1920s era home that is filled with history, art, and beautiful gardens. 5. Water sports - Being a coastal city, it’s no surprise that Fort Lauderdale has plenty of water activities available. From kayaking and paddleboarding to jet skiing and parasailing, there are plenty of ways to get out on the water and enjoy the sunshine.
